Across the school, in a celebration of our community, we hold cultural evenings at least twice a year. We have established links with sister schools in France, India, and Uganda. We also promote an understanding of citizenship and British Values through school visits to central London, rural and coastal areas.
We work with local theatre groups of professional actors to perform both classical and modern drama including our annual Shakespeare festival and termly music recitals for the whole community.
All of our children are encouraged to learn a musical instrument. We currently have developed our Commonwealth Choir which will be performing throughout the summer at events across the borough. Our annual music festival in June showcases some of our talented children.
We encourage parental involvement in our learning through parent workshops and coffee mornings that reflect the needs of all pupils and parents from online safety to phonics and healthy eating.
We offer a large selection of after school clubs including boxercising, sewing club and one to one tuition to ensure that all children meet their full potential.
